Ingredients You’ll Need for Strawberry Sorbet
- 2 cups fresh strawberries, hulled
- 1/2 cup sugar
- 1 cup water
- 1 tablespoon lemon juice
Let’s Make It Together
- In a blender, combine the strawberries, sugar, water, and lemon juice. Blend until smooth, letting those vibrant flavors swirl together.
- Pour the mixture into a shallow dish. This helps it freeze evenly. Pop it into the freezer for about 2 hours, stirring every 30 minutes to break up any ice crystals that may form.
- Once the sorbet is firm and fluffy, scoop it into bowls and serve. Enjoy your refreshing treat as you bask in the sunshine!

Chef Emma’s Helpful Tips
- Make Ahead: This sorbet can be made a day in advance. Just take it out of the freezer about 10 minutes before serving for easy scooping.
- Ingredient Swaps: If strawberries aren’t in season, feel free to try frozen strawberries. Just thaw them slightly before blending.
- Storage: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the freezer for up to a week. Just remember, the longer it sits, the icier it becomes.
- Slicing Trick: Use a warm scoop or spoon to help get clean, beautiful scoops of sorbet without any struggle.
